Output ed8cdc75d229cb166322d2009b45ec546940a76b87619be5693bf2f2fc13cc59:0

value
40000000
script pubkey
OP_0 OP_PUSHBYTES_20 75d1c23908fcc6832047daed73bebf1971cd2bbf
address
bc1qwhguywgglnrgxgz8mtkh804lr9cu62alxqjjrk
transaction
ed8cdc75d229cb166322d2009b45ec546940a76b87619be5693bf2f2fc13cc59
confirmations
1176
spent
false

154 Sat Ranges